Up to 40% off at checkout! So Long 2020! Free Shipping for orders over $99

M Made in Italy

M made in Italy
M made in Italy is a complete lifestyle collection.
Established in 2008, in Montreal – the most European of Canadian cities.
The line features natural fabrics, a variety of prints and textures, comfortable fits; all with an excellent quality/price ratio and proudly “Made in Italy"
0 products

Sorry, there are no products in this collection